How to Grow Every Day Without Chasing Success
When we talk about a winning vision, it all starts with mindset. Success isn’t something you hunt for like a lost book or a hidden treasure. It’s not about chasing after medals or rewards. The real journey is about transforming yourself from the inside out.
Instead of asking, “How do I find success?” ask, “What can I change about myself?” It’s about the habits you build, the way you spend your days, and the small investments you make in yourself every single day. Each day is a new chance to move up a level. That’s what I focus on: going to the next level, step by step.
So, what can you do every day, consistently, to become the person you want to be? The answer is simple: do a little bit, but do it every day. Consistency is what pays off. It’s not about making huge leaps, but about showing up daily, no matter what. That’s how you move closer to the mindset and habits that lead to real success.
It’s all about habits. It’s about repeating, tweaking, and changing. Only a fool expects things to change by doing the same thing over and over. If you want different results, you have to do things differently. You have to try, adjust, and try again. That’s the only way forward.
